The rebellion shattered the pack's trust, and Aradia felt it like chains around her wrists. Even as Kael stood firm beside her, she knew some wolves would never accept her.

And Ronan knew it too.

She found him waiting at the river that night, the moonlight gilding his copper hair, his amber eyes glowing with dangerous promise.

"You think this ends with them bowing to you?" he asked softly, stepping closer. "It will not. They will never see you as one of them. You are fire. You are storm. And storms are feared, never loved."

Her chest heaved, torn. "Kael loves me."

His smile was sharp. "He wants you. He needs you. But love? Love is freedom, not chains. And you are bound tighter every day."

He brushed her cheek, his touch feather-light but searing. "Come with me. Leave him. I will not cage you. I will not bind you. I will let you burn as you were meant to."

Her lips parted, trembling. His words cut into her heart, exposing her fears. For a breathless moment, she swayed toward him, her pulse racing, her body aching with temptation.

But then Kael's vow echoed in her memory: You are mine, in this life and every life after.

Her tears spilled. She caught Ronan's hand and pushed it away. "No. My fire is his. My soul is his. I will never be yours."

For the first time, Ronan's mask cracked. His amber eyes darkened with fury, his jaw tightening.

"Then you will burn with him," he whispered. "And when the ashes fall, don't say I didn't warn you."

And then he vanished into the forest, leaving her trembling, her choice made—but the danger of it still heavy in her chest.
